Why glove returns happen in the first place
Most sizing rests on very little information. A size chart usually asks for one or two numbers, then maps them to small, medium, or large. However, a hand is far richer than that. Length, palm breadth, circumference, finger proportions, the thumb, and the wrist all shape whether a glove actually fits.
When the input is coarse, the output is a guess. As a result, customers hesitate, pick the wrong size, or order two and send one back. For example, a buyer between sizes will often order both — and that single habit can quietly inflate a product's return rate.
Gloves make this harder than most categories. They wrap the hand closely, so a few millimeters change everything. Additionally, performance buyers care about fit more than almost any other feature. A loose golf glove or a tight cycling glove is not a minor annoyance; it is a reason to send the order back.
The hidden costs behind every return
A return is never just shipping a box back. In fact, each one carries several costs at once:
- Margin lost to return shipping, restocking, and inspection.
- Inventory stuck in transit instead of on the shelf.
- Trust chipped away when a customer feels they guessed wrong.
- Data that never improves, because the next buyer starts from the same coarse chart.
Therefore, returns compound. The more you sell on weak fit data, the more you pay later — and the harder it becomes to break the cycle.
How to reduce glove return rates with real hand data
To reduce glove return rates, you have to replace guesswork with geometry. In other words, give the sizing decision more to work with than a single circled number on a chart.
A phone-based capture can do exactly that. Instead of asking the customer to measure with a ruler, a guided capture reads the hand and produces metric geometry — hand length, palm breadth, circumference, finger-root anchors, and wrist dimensions. Consequently, the size recommendation rests on the real shape of the hand, not a rough proxy.
This matters because better input narrows the decision. When a buyer sees a confident, specific size, they stop ordering two. Additionally, they trust the result, which means fewer "just in case" returns land back on your dock.

Why this matters even more for performance gloves
Performance categories raise the stakes. A golfer feels a half-size error on every swing, and a goalkeeper notices a loose finger immediately. As a result, fit complaints turn into returns faster in sport than almost anywhere else.
These customers also buy again and again. Therefore, a good first fit does double duty: it prevents one return today and earns the repeat purchase tomorrow. Conversely, a bad first fit can lose the customer entirely, not just the single sale.
Better geometry helps across the catalog, from batting and motorcycle gloves to work and specialty styles. In short, the more fit drives the buy, the more real hand data pays you back.
